How to start a craft business

Getting started with your own craft business is easy with a few hints and tips. Working for yourself using a craft that you love, can be a life-changing experience. In this article, find the relevant information on how to start a craft business.

From materials to equipment

Check that you have the basics in order before starting your business. Where are you going to make your crafts? Select a room in the house, space in the garage or a shed that will just be a craft area. It should be a place where you can leave stuff to dry, have room to paint and store all your materials. Materials Materials are going to be needed, whatever your craft choice. Having a craft business could mean more sales and more materials needed. There are sources where you can get your materials cheaply and easily. You need to be able to get supplies in a day if you have an urgent order. Stock up on everything before you start. Equipment Make sure that you have all the equipment you need. For instance, will you need a better sewing machine for cloth crafts or a more up to date scroll saw for wooden crafts? You may be able to apply for funding for some of your business start-up essentials.

Getting yourself known

Decide on a name for your home craft business. You might want to use your own name, but also consider other names that you could use which really explains what your business is about. Publicity Publicity is everything. You won’t get sales unless you can find customers and they can find you. Consider whether to have a website with examples of your work posted on it. You can update it with specials and even run a blog so that people gain an understanding of life as a craftsperson. Craft fairs Posters can be used locally and leaflets can be left in places like doctors surgeries, dentists and shops. You will need to let people know that you have crafts to make and sell. One way of doing this is to attend craft fairs, car boots and fair days with examples of your work for sale. You might also be able to give demonstrations and talks on your work.
